Liquor Licenses1908

 

Waupaca Record

April 23, 1908

 

MUST BE CITIZENS

 

            After the first Tuesday in July no person will be permitted to take out a license for the sale of liquor who is not a full citizen of the United States and of the State of Wisconsin, as well as of the town, village or city in which the license is applied for.

            The law also provides that no person shall be granted a license who has been convicted of an offense against the laws of the state punishable by imprisonment in the state prison.  The law is wide in its applications covering all villages, towns and cities whether operating under the general law or special charter.  It becomes effective this year and applications for citizenship must have been filed prior to March 1.
